Konrad Charmatz
When World War II erupted in Europe, Konrad Charmatz was a prospering businessman in Sosnowiec, Poland, a loving son and an aspiring poet. For the next seven years he witnesses the Holocaust as it destroyed his family, country and culture. This is his memoir of those years.
